Rumor: Shearman & Sterling Laying Off Support Staff

According to rumors on the Tubes (it’s not a truck!), Shearman & Sterling is laying off administrative staff today.

Lawyers are apparently unaffected. An official announcement is expected tomorrow.

Two weeks ago, Shearman & Sterling reported a 4.9% drop in revenues to $876 million for 2008, and a 9.6% fall in profits per equity partner, to $1.665 million. Revenue per lawyer remained above the million-dollar mark.

Shearman & Sterling LLP is a law firm headquartered in New York City, with 19 offices located in major financial centers around the world. It was founded in 1873.

As of 2006, it was the 17th largest law firm in the world as measured by 2006 annual revenue. Shearman & Sterling is a white shoe firm, the equivalent of the Magic Circle in the UK.
